Why Nail Polish Cracks: Causes And Prevention Tips

why is nail polish cracking

Nail polish cracking is a common issue that many individuals face, often leaving their manicures looking less than perfect. This frustrating problem can occur due to various factors, such as improper application techniques, low-quality products, or environmental conditions. Understanding the reasons behind nail polish cracking is essential for achieving long-lasting and flawless nail art. By identifying the causes, one can take preventive measures and make informed choices to ensure a smooth and durable finish. Whether it's adjusting application methods or selecting suitable products, addressing these factors can significantly improve the overall appearance and longevity of nail polish.

Application mistakes: Too thick coats, skipping base coat, or improper drying time cause cracking

Nail polish cracking often stems from application errors that compromise its durability. One common mistake is applying coats that are too thick, which may seem like a time-saver but actually traps moisture and prevents proper curing. This trapped moisture expands as it dries, creating stress points that lead to cracks. To avoid this, aim for thin, even layers—no thicker than the consistency of a coat of paint. Each layer should be about 0.05 mm, roughly the thickness of a piece of paper.

Skipping the base coat is another frequent oversight. A base coat acts as a primer, smoothing the nail surface and creating a foundation for polish adhesion. Without it, polish clings unevenly to the nail, leading to weak spots that crack under pressure. Think of it as building a house without a foundation—the structure is inherently unstable. Always use a base coat, allowing it to dry for at least 2 minutes before applying color.

Improper drying time exacerbates cracking, especially when layers are rushed. Nail polish requires time to cure fully, typically 10–15 minutes per coat. Using a fan or quick-dry drops can reduce this time but doesn’t eliminate the need for patience. Rushing to apply a second coat or engaging in activities like typing or handling objects can smudge wet polish, causing it to crack as it sets. Treat drying time as non-negotiable—set a timer if necessary.

Comparing proper application to improper methods highlights the importance of technique. For instance, a thin coat with a base layer and adequate drying time results in a smooth, chip-resistant finish lasting up to 7 days. Conversely, thick coats without a base and rushed drying yield a brittle surface that cracks within 24 hours. The difference lies in respecting the polish’s chemistry and allowing it to bond correctly.

To summarize, cracking nail polish is often self-inflicted through avoidable mistakes. Prioritize thin coats, never skip the base, and respect drying times. These steps ensure a longer-lasting manicure and save time in the long run by reducing the need for frequent touch-ups. Treat your nails like a canvas—preparation and patience are key to a flawless finish.

Old polish: Expired or dried-out polish loses flexibility, leading to cracks

Nail polish, like any cosmetic product, has a shelf life. After 1-2 years, the solvents in the formula begin to evaporate, causing the polish to thicken and lose its flexibility. This is why old or expired polish often cracks shortly after application. The once-smooth film becomes brittle, unable to withstand the natural movement and bending of your nails.

Imagine painting a rubber band with glue and letting it dry. The glue, initially flexible, becomes rigid and cracks when the rubber band stretches. This is similar to what happens when you use old polish.

To determine if your polish is past its prime, check for changes in texture and smell. If it’s become goopy, separated, or has developed an unpleasant odor, it’s time to replace it. Even if the polish looks usable, its performance will be compromised. Cracking is just one issue; old polish may also chip more easily, apply unevenly, or fail to adhere properly to the nail surface.

For optimal results, store your polish in a cool, dark place, away from direct sunlight and extreme temperatures. This slows down the evaporation process and extends the product’s lifespan. Additionally, avoid shaking the bottle vigorously, as this can introduce air bubbles that further dry out the formula.

If you’re determined to salvage a beloved shade, consider adding a few drops of nail polish thinner (not acetone) to restore some of its original consistency. However, this is a temporary fix, and the polish will likely continue to deteriorate over time. Investing in a fresh bottle is the most reliable solution to prevent cracking and ensure a flawless manicure. Remember, using old polish not only compromises the appearance of your nails but can also lead to uneven wear and potential nail damage.

Nail prep: Oily or unclean nails prevent polish adhesion, resulting in cracks

Nails naturally produce oil, and while this is healthy for nail flexibility, it’s the enemy of long-lasting polish. Even a thin, invisible layer of oil acts as a barrier, preventing the polish from gripping the nail surface. Think of it like painting on a greasy surface—the paint slides around and never truly bonds. This lack of adhesion is a primary reason for cracks, chips, and peeling, no matter how high-quality your polish is.

Pre-Polish Ritual: The 3-Step Cleanse

Before applying polish, follow this non-negotiable routine:

  • Wash with Soap and Water: Use a gentle nail brush to remove dirt and surface oils. Warm water softens the nails, allowing for deeper cleaning.
  • Dehydrate with Alcohol: Wipe each nail with 91% isopropyl alcohol or a lint-free pad soaked in nail polish remover. This eliminates residual oils and moisture, creating a dry, porous surface for polish to cling to.
  • Gently Buff: Use a fine-grit buffer (240/280 grit) to smooth ridges and create micro-texture. Over-buffing can weaken nails, so limit this step to 5–10 seconds per nail.

The Science of Adhesion

Nail polish formulas rely on chemical bonding to the nail plate. Oils and debris disrupt this process by filling the microscopic grooves of the nail, leaving nowhere for the polish to anchor. Even non-visible residues from hand creams, sunscreen, or kitchen grease can sabotage adhesion. For oily nail types, consider a mattifying base coat designed to absorb excess oil, providing a grippier foundation.

Troubleshooting for Stubborn Oils

If your nails still feel slippery post-cleanse, try a DIY oil-busting hack: mix equal parts white vinegar and water, soak nails for 30 seconds, then rinse. Vinegar’s acidity breaks down oils without drying out the nail bed. For chronic oiliness, apply a matte top coat as a base layer—its flat finish counteracts shine and improves grip.

The Takeaway: Clean Nails = Crack-Free Manicures

Skipping nail prep is like building a house on quicksand. Invest 5 minutes in proper cleansing, and your polish will reward you with days (or weeks) of flawless wear. Remember: adhesion starts with subtraction—removing barriers, not just adding layers. Treat your nails like a canvas, and prep them with the same care an artist gives to their surface.

Environmental factors: Humidity, heat, or cold can affect polish durability and cause cracking

Nail polish, a seemingly simple cosmetic, is surprisingly vulnerable to the whims of the environment. Humidity, heat, and cold don't just affect your comfort level; they can wreak havoc on your manicure. Understanding these environmental factors is key to achieving long-lasting, chip-free nails.

Humidity: The Silent Saboteur

High humidity levels act like a double-edged sword for nail polish. On one hand, moisture in the air can slow down drying time, leading to smudges and imperfections. Imagine meticulously painting your nails, only to have them marred by a stray hair or a misplaced finger because the polish hasn't fully set. On the other hand, excessive moisture can cause the polish to become brittle and prone to cracking. Think of it like leaving a wooden board outside in the rain – it warps and cracks over time. To combat humidity's effects, aim for a balanced environment when painting your nails. Air conditioning or a dehumidifier can be your allies, creating a drier atmosphere conducive to proper polish drying.

Heat: The Accelerated Aging Process

Heat accelerates the drying process of nail polish, which might seem like a good thing. However, this rapid drying can lead to shrinkage and stress on the polish film, resulting in cracks and chips. Imagine baking a cake at too high a temperature – it rises quickly but then cracks and collapses. Similarly, exposing your freshly painted nails to direct sunlight or hot water immediately after application can have detrimental effects. Allow your polish to dry naturally in a cool, shaded area for optimal results.

Cold: The Brittle Breaker

Cold temperatures have the opposite effect of heat, causing nail polish to become brittle and susceptible to cracking. This is because cold air lacks moisture, leading to dryness. Think of how your skin feels tight and dry in winter – the same principle applies to your nail polish. To minimize the impact of cold weather, avoid exposing your nails to extreme cold immediately after painting. Wearing gloves outdoors and using a moisturizing hand cream can help maintain nail flexibility and prevent cracking.

Practical Tips for Environmental Nail Care

  • Timing is Everything: Choose a time to paint your nails when the environment is moderate – not too hot, not too cold, and with manageable humidity.
  • Layering is Key: Apply thin coats of polish, allowing each layer to dry completely before adding the next. This prevents thick, uneven application which is more prone to cracking.
  • Top Coat Protection: A good quality top coat acts as a shield, protecting your polish from environmental stressors and extending its lifespan.
  • Moisturize Regularly: Keep your cuticles and nails hydrated with a nourishing oil or cream to maintain flexibility and prevent brittleness.

By understanding how humidity, heat, and cold influence nail polish durability, you can take proactive steps to ensure your manicure stays flawless for longer. Remember, a little environmental awareness goes a long way in achieving beautiful, chip-free nails.

Low-quality products: Cheap polish or top coat lacks resilience, making cracks more likely

Nail polish cracking can often be traced back to the quality of the products used. Cheap polish or top coats are frequently culprits due to their lack of resilience. These budget-friendly options may seem appealing, but they often skimp on key ingredients like polymers and plasticizers, which are essential for flexibility and durability. When applied, these low-quality formulas dry brittle, unable to withstand everyday stresses like typing, washing dishes, or even minor bumps. The result? Hairline cracks or chips that mar your manicure within hours or days, rather than the week-long wear promised by higher-quality brands.

Consider the science behind it: nail polish is essentially a complex blend of resins, solvents, and pigments. Premium brands invest in advanced formulations that balance hardness and flexibility, ensuring the polish adheres well and resists cracking. In contrast, cheaper alternatives often use inferior resins that harden too quickly or lack the necessary elasticity. For instance, a top coat with insufficient plasticizers will form a rigid film that cannot expand or contract with the natural movement of your nails, leading to cracks. If you’ve ever noticed your manicure splitting after a day of light activity, this is likely the reason.

To avoid this issue, invest in mid-to-high-range polishes and top coats known for their resilience. Look for terms like "long-lasting," "chip-resistant," or "flexible formula" on the label. Brands like OPI, Essie, or CND are renowned for their durable products, which, while pricier, offer better value in the long run. Additionally, apply thin, even coats rather than one thick layer, as this allows the polish to cure properly and reduces the risk of brittleness. A good rule of thumb is to spend at least $8–$12 on a quality top coat, as it’s the final barrier protecting your manicure from wear and tear.

If you’re on a tight budget, there are still ways to minimize cracking. Opt for drugstore brands with positive reviews for durability, such as Sally Hansen or Wet n Wild’s better-formulated lines. Always pair your polish with a reputable top coat, as this is where most of the protection comes from. Avoid quick-dry top coats if they’re not from trusted brands, as they often sacrifice flexibility for speed. Lastly, consider using a nail strengthener as a base coat to add an extra layer of resilience, especially if your nails are naturally weak or prone to peeling.

In the end, the old adage "you get what you pay for" holds true for nail polish. While cheap products might save you a few dollars upfront, they often lead to frustration and frequent touch-ups. By prioritizing quality, you not only extend the life of your manicure but also save time and effort in the long run. Think of it as an investment in your nails’ health and appearance—one that pays dividends every time you admire your flawless, crack-free polish.
